## Who to ping about GiftNote

Welcome aboard! GiftNote is our donation-receipt mailer for the Larchfield Fund. Template tweaks go to the comms folks; delivery failures and bounce weirdness go to the platform crew. Don't push template changes on Fridays — receipts batch over the weekend. For anything GiftNote-related, start with the address below.

billing contact of kaweg-tajeg = drudor.lamion.oliath@torvalabs.test

Environments for Glyphcellar, our font-vendoring service. We never fetch third-party fonts at build time; instead, licensed families are vendored into an internal artifact store and served from there. Dev and staging share a store, while production uses an isolated replica with stricter checksum enforcement. New team members should verify license metadata before adding any family. Each environment reads its settings at startup, and the values currently used by staging are reproduced below for reference.

service settings:
novath:
  pin: 1396
  tenant: pelys
  seal: seal_ccc035e1
  metrics_host: metrics.novath.qorvelworks.test
  standby_team: fraeth
  escalation: drueth-zorok
  nonce: 61d508

Hey, reviewer hat on — here's the gist of blue-green for the Ledgerfin billing worker. We run two identical worker pools, swap traffic at the queue router, and keep the old pool warm for 30 minutes in case invoices misbehave. Check that the migration guard in my PR blocks cutover when schema versions diverge; that bit me last quarter. Once you approve, the cutover script verifies each artifact before the swap, and it does that using the deploy key shown below.

release key, kawif-hawep: bky13_X7TGuRG4Zu4ZJ

**Checklist — Off-site run: Torchlight Revue props**

- [ ] Load the three crates of stage props for the Torchlight Revue from Bay 4 — the papier-mâché dragon head goes on top, please, it dents easily.
- [ ] Double-check the inventory sheet against the tour manager's list before the truck leaves Fenwood Depot.
- [ ] Photograph each crate seal for our records.

Once everything's strapped in, note the hand-over instruction below.

handover note for yagef-bagep: the drudor pelius courier leaves the kasdor zorvan norir ledger at gate 8016 under passcode 755406